4 O.C. Congress members skip final votes (OC Reg; Total Buzz)

     Christmas break seems to have started a little earlier for four of Orange County’s six congressional representatives, who missed today’s voting on bills for continuing funding for the federal government and for a food safety bill.
     Among the more than 70 House members listed as not voting on those bills are O.C. Reps. Ken Calvert, R-Corona; John Campbell, R-Irvine; Gary Miller, R-Diamond Bar; and Loretta Sanchez, D-Santa Ana.
     Sticking around for final votes on those two bills were Reps. Dana Rohrabacher, R-Huntington Beach and Ed Royce, R-Fullerton. The two opposed both measures, although both passed.
